NCT ID: NCT04312672 Active, not recruiting - Clinical trials for X-Linked Retinitis Pigmentosa

Long-term Follow-up Gene Therapy Study for RPGR- XLRP

Start date: July 31, 2017
Phase:
Study type: Observational

This is a long-term follow-up study assessing safety of patients for up to 60 months following advanced therapy investigational medicinal product (ATIMP) AAV5-hRKp.RPGR vector in participants with XLRP caused by mutations in RPGR.

NCT ID: NCT03316560 Active, not recruiting - Clinical trials for X-Linked Retinitis Pigmentosa

Safety and Efficacy of rAAV2tYF-GRK1-RPGR in Subjects With X-linked Retinitis Pigmentosa Caused by RPGR Mutations

HORIZON
Start date: April 16, 2018
Phase: Phase 1/Phase 2
Study type: Interventional

This study will evaluate the safety and efficacy of a recombinant adeno-associated virus vector (rAAV2tYF-GRK1-RPGR) in patients with X-linked retinitis pigmentosa caused by RPGR mutations.

NCT ID: NCT03252847 Completed - Clinical trials for X-Linked Retinitis Pigmentosa

Gene Therapy for X-linked Retinitis Pigmentosa (XLRP) - Retinitis Pigmentosa GTPase Regulator (RPGR)

Start date: July 14, 2017
Phase: Phase 1/Phase 2
Study type: Interventional

The Phase 1 part of the study is a dose escalation of subretinal administration of AAV2/5 vector to assess the safety of this vector in participants with XLRP caused by mutations in RPGR. The Phase 2 part of the study is a cohort expansion of subretinal administration of AAV2/5 vector to assess the safety and efficacy of this vector in participants with XLRP caused by mutations in RPGR.

NCT ID: NCT03116113 Completed - Clinical trials for X-Linked Retinitis Pigmentosa

A Clinical Trial of Retinal Gene Therapy for X-linked Retinitis Pigmentosa Using BIIB112

XIRIUS
Start date: March 8, 2017
Phase: Phase 1/Phase 2
Study type: Interventional

The objective of the study is to evaluate the safety, tolerability and efficacy of a single sub-retinal injection of BIIB112 in participants with X-linked retinitis pigmentosa (XLRP).
